The company, beating heart of the Group, is located in Osoppo in the province of Udine. Fantoni is internationally renowned as an industrial entity in the production of office furniture, chipboard and MDF panels. The historical milestone that embodies the company’s philosophy is the Multipli project, a range of furniture, designed by architect Gino Valle in 1968, to suit office environments. This solution aims to replace the ‘top-down structure'' office concept with an open system in constant evolution by using the modular shape and dimensions. The concept is bare of all decorative and functional details, including the handles. The basic concept of the Multipli collection with its unmistakable 45° angle, that visually cancels the thickness of the tops making of the single piece a perfect volume, can be found in most of Fantoni’s operative and executive collections. The plants in Rivoli di Osoppo cover an area of about 1 square kilometer, a workforce of 700 people and contain investments that exceed 350 million euros.
